Description:
A megalithic monument is a prehistoric construction involving one or several roughly hewn stone slabs of great size. These monuments are found in various parts of the world, but the best known and most numerous are concentrated in Western Europe, including Brittany, the British Isles, Iberia, S France, S Scandinavia, and N Germany.
